A warmer loft starts with knowing what is hiding up there

Cold rooms, draughts and uneven temperatures often point to more than thin insulation alone. From our Gorebridge base, we combine loft insulation upgrades with checks for roof space issues that could affect comfort, condensation and the long term health of the roof.

At Ridgeline Roofing Expert Ltd, we inspect existing insulation depth and coverage, look for signs of moisture coming in from roof faults and use thermal imaging where helpful to identify likely cold spots and gaps. That means you are not insulating over hidden trouble. If we find damaged timbers or defects in the roof space, we can factor those repairs into the plan before the upgrade moves ahead.

Do the insulation work once, and do it on sound ground

Insulation performs best when the loft around it is dry, stable and ventilated properly. With Ridgeline Roofing Expert Ltd, we explain how roof ventilation and moisture control affect the result, and we can carry out timber or structural repairs in the attic space where deterioration has taken hold. Frequently asked questions

Can poor insulation lead to condensation problems too?

Poor insulation can contribute to uneven temperatures and cold surfaces, but condensation often also involves ventilation and moisture levels in the loft. That is why we look at the roof space as a whole rather than assuming extra insulation alone will solve every comfort or damp related issue.

Should roof faults be repaired before loft insulation goes in?

Yes, where faults are present. If water is getting into the loft or timber is deteriorating, those issues should be addressed first. Insulating over leaks or damp can make the problem harder to spot later and may reduce the performance of the new insulation as well.

Is this useful when buying a property?

Very much so. A loft and roof space check can show you how the insulation is performing, whether there are signs of hidden moisture and if the structure appears to need attention. That gives you clearer information before purchase instead of unpleasant surprises after you move in.
